# Zep Memory Assistant
We're building an AI Agent with human-like memory which integrates [Zep's](https://www.getzep.com/) long-term memory backend with Microsoft's AutoGen framework, enabling agents to retain, recall, and manage contextual memory across conversations—paving the way for more intelligent, personalized, and persistent multi-agent interactions.
We use:
- [Zep](https://www.getzep.com/) for the memory layer to AI agent
- Autogen (Agent Orchestration)
- Ollama as Model Provider
- Qwen 3 (LLM)
- Streamlit to wrap the logic in an interactive UI
## Set Up
Run these commands in project root
### Setting up Ollama
```bash
# Setting up Ollama on linux
curl -fsSL https://ollama.com/install.sh | sh
# Pull the Qwen 3 4B model
ollama pull qwen3:4b
```
### Install Dependencies
```bash
uv sync
```
### Run the Application
Run the application with:
```bash
streamlit run app.py
```
